Solution for 36=3x+3(-3x-8) equation:


Simplifying
36 = 3x + 3(-3x + -8)

Reorder the terms:
36 = 3x + 3(-8 + -3x)
36 = 3x + (-8 * 3 + -3x * 3)
36 = 3x + (-24 + -9x)

Reorder the terms:
36 = -24 + 3x + -9x

Combine like terms: 3x + -9x = -6x
36 = -24 + -6x

Solving
36 = -24 + -6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'6x' to each side of the equation.
36 + 6x = -24 + -6x + 6x

Combine like terms: -6x + 6x = 0
36 + 6x = -24 + 0
36 + 6x = -24

Add '-36' to each side of the equation.
36 + -36 + 6x = -24 + -36

Combine like terms: 36 + -36 = 0
0 + 6x = -24 + -36
6x = -24 + -36

Combine like terms: -24 + -36 = -60
6x = -60

Divide each side by '6'.
x = -10

Simplifying
x = -10
